    Abstract: An apparatus for sealing the tail of a wound roll of sheet material. A pair of parallel rotatable rollers define a tail separation station and a tail wind-up station that are disposed longitudinally along the length of the rollers A wound roll is positioned at the tail separating station and rotated about its axis. Air jets mounted adjacent the rollers separate the tail from the body of the roll, and the separated tail is supported on an apron that extends laterally from the rollers. After separation of the tail, rotation of the rollers is stopped and the roll with the separated tail is moved longitudinally along the rollers to the wind-up station. A strip of adhesive is applied to the tail from a fixed adhesive head as the tail is moved to the wind-up station. At the wind-up station the roll is rotated to wind the separated tail back onto the body of the roll.
